Latest Patents
Hyeran Kim holds a patent for a method that greatly improves the production efficiency of genome-modified plants derived from plant protoplasts. This innovative method employs a Cas protein-guide RNA ribonucleoprotein (RNP) to optimize the regeneration of gene-edited plants. The resulting technique not only allows for the proficient production of target gene-mutated plants but also minimizes the introduction of foreign DNA, thereby making it highly beneficial across diverse sectors such as agriculture, food, and biotechnology.
